The story of a man trying to get married while navigating a tumultuous relationship with his future brother-in-law is simple, but the execution is manic. Basil Joseph continues to prove he is one of the finest comic actors of his generation, delivering a performance that is both absurd and endearing. While the climax leans a bit too heavily into chaos, the first half is a masterclass in comedic timing. latest malayalam comedy films
